GENEVA - The World Health Organization (WHO) has declared a global flu pandemic after holding an emergency meeting, according to reports. It means the swine flu virus is spreading in at least two regions of the world with rising cases being seen in the UK, Australia, Japan and Chile.

USA - Sir Nigel Sheinwald, the British ambassador to Washington, has called on the United States to resist "creeping protectionism" in response to the global economic downturn. Delivering a speech in Chicago, a major trading centre, Sir Nigel warned that the "Buy American" trend was putting at risk years of growth in trade between the US and Britain.
MOGADISHU - Sitting on a mat at home between taking orders for arms on his two mobile phones, Osman Bare gives thanks for the riches flowing from Somalia's war. "I have only been in the weapon business five years, but I have erected three villas. I have also opened shops for my two wives," said the 40-year-old, one of about 400 Somali men operating in Mogadishu's main weapons market.
